Bibiani Goldstars sacks Head Coach Frimpong Manso
Ghana Premier League Champions Bibiani Goldstars, has parted ways with its Head Coach, Frimpong Manso with immediate effect, barely a season after he guided the club to their historic league triumph.
The decision came in the wake of Goldstars’ 2-0 defeat to Algerian giants, JS Kabylie in the first leg of the 2025/2026 CAF Champions League preliminary stage qualifiers, played over the weekend.
The loss had left the Ghanaian champions with a mountain to climb ahead of the decisive second leg in Algeria.
Mr. Samuel Kwagyire, the Public Relations Officer (PRO) for the club, who confirmed the development to the GNA, described it as a top-level management decision.
